Anambra Lawmaker Udoba Urges APGA Members to Engage in Membership Digitization

Hon. Patrick Obalum-Udoba, representing Anambra West Constituency in the Anambra State House of Assembly, has called on members of the All Progressives Grand Alliance (APGA) to actively participate in the party’s newly launched online registration exercise. The initiative, which began today, aims to register both existing and new members nationwide.

Speaking from his Umueze Anam country home, Hon. Obalum-Udoba highlighted that this digitization effort is the first of its kind in Nigeria and will significantly enhance the party’s reach and efficiency across the country. He emphasized that the new system will streamline intra-party activities and improve organizational effectiveness.

He praised the national chairman of APGA, Barrister Sly Ezeokenwa, and his national working committee for their innovative approach in implementing this digital initiative. He also expressed gratitude to Governor Chukwuma Soludo for endorsing the project.

Hon. Obalum-Udoba described APGA as a unique political party focused on inclusive development, support for the vulnerable, and equitable resource distribution among Nigerians. He urged constituents of Ndi Anambra West to engage fully in the registration process, ensuring they become verified members to benefit from the party’s offerings.

He also noted that Governor Soludo’s excellent performance would bolster the party’s prospects in the next gubernatorial election in Anambra. Hon. Obalum-Udoba encouraged the citizens and residents of the state to continue supporting the Soludo administration by fulfilling their civic duties.
